In the world of Counter-Strike 2, pattern IDs play a crucial role in determining the value and rarity of weapon skins. Each skin is generated based on specific parameters, including its pattern ID, which uniquely identifies the visual attributes of the skin. For instance, two skins of the same type might have different appearances due to their distinct pattern IDs, influencing not just their aesthetic appeal but also their market price. Skins with rare pattern IDs often fetch higher prices as collectors and players seek out unique designs that stand out in the game.
Additionally, understanding how pattern IDs correlate with skin value allows players to make informed decisions when buying or trading skins. Some patterns may be considered more desirable due to their association with fluctuating market trends or player preferences. To put it simply, the rarity of a skin can often be linked back to its pattern ID, which leads to increased demand and ultimately a higher price. As players navigate the intricate world of CS2 skins, being aware of these patterns and their implications can enhance both their gameplay experience and investment strategy.
